Course overview
From the outset, this programme prepares you to excel in the dynamic world of music production, sound design, and audio engineering. Youll graduate with a substantial portfolio of music and audio work, created using cutting-edge technology, industry software and hardware, setting you apart as a well-prepared professional in the music industry.

The curriculum emphasises the development of your technical abilities, creative practices, artistic imagination, production skills, and academic understanding. You will cover everything from studio engineering, to sampling and sound synthesis, and becoming a cultural citizen. Youll delve into critical and cultural theories, appreciate the societal context of sound, music, and technology, and gain first-hand industry experience through innovative placement modules and professional engagement activities with our external partners.

The programme also offers flexibility, allowing you to tailor your degree through a selection of optional core modules. These modules enable you to broaden your understanding of various career pathways or to actively engage with the world beyond Keele - whether through a work placement, client-based projects, or collaborative efforts to deliver successful festivals or events.

This thoughtfully designed curriculum strikes a perfect balance between theoretical and practical learning. Music Production and Sound Design at Keele will ensure you are well-prepared for career paths in music production, sound recording, audio engineering, audio-visual production, and broadcasting.

Work placements
Having the opportunity to undertake a placement is a valuable experience which will enable you to demonstrate and develop your skill set further. Through this course you will become a creative individual with the ability to critically evaluate, synthesise and produce content effectively.

You may choose to apply for a Work Placement Year that allows you to apply your knowledge and prepare for employment after university through a year long placement. This will enable you to build your confidence in the workplace and demonstrate your abilities in a professional environment, using the skills you have gained throughout your degree programme.

Your future career

As a Music Production and Sound Design graduate you will be ideally placed for employment, or further training within the creative industries, including sound recording, music production, game audio, audio streaming, and broadcasting.

You will develop the skills and experience for a future in the public arts, teaching, postgraduate studies, and academia or as an independent musician/artist.
